The main differences between Ostrich and Beef shank

  • Ostrich is richer in Vitamin B12, Vitamin B5, Selenium, Vitamin B6, Vitamin B3, Vitamin B1, and Vitamin B2, yet Beef shank is richer in Zinc, and Iron.
  • Daily need coverage for Vitamin B12 from Ostrich is 102% higher.
  • Ostrich contains 3 times more Vitamin B5 than Beef shank. Ostrich contains 1.318mg of Vitamin B5, while Beef shank contains 0.41mg.
  • Ostrich contains less Saturated Fat.

Food types used in this article are Ostrich, tip trimmed, cooked and Beef, shank crosscuts, separable lean only, trimmed to 1/4" fat, choice, cooked, simmered.

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ient Ostrich Beef shank Opinion
Protein 28.49g 33.68g Beef shank
Fats 2.57g 6.36g Beef shank
Calories 145kcal 201kcal Beef shank
Calcium 6mg 32mg Beef shank
Iron 2.79mg 3.86mg Beef shank
Magnesium 25mg 30mg Beef shank
Phosphorus 251mg 263mg Beef shank
Potassium 362mg 447mg Beef shank
Sodium 80mg 64mg Beef shank
Zinc 4.85mg 10.49mg Beef shank
Copper 0.152mg 0.172mg Beef shank
Manganese 0.019mg 0.02mg Beef shank
Selenium 37.5µg 30µg Ostrich
Vitamin E 0.23mg Ostrich
Vitamin B1 0.232mg 0.14mg Ostrich
Vitamin B2 0.292mg 0.21mg Ostrich
Vitamin B3 7.143mg 5.89mg Ostrich
Vitamin B5 1.318mg 0.41mg Ostrich
Vitamin B6 0.545mg 0.37mg Ostrich
Folate 15µg 10µg Ostrich
Vitamin B12 6.25µg 3.79µg Ostrich
Tryptophan 0.254mg 0.377mg Beef shank
Threonine 1.25mg 1.471mg Beef shank
Isoleucine 1.354mg 1.514mg Beef shank
Leucine 2.315mg 2.662mg Beef shank
Lysine 2.516mg 2.802mg Beef shank
Methionine 0.796mg 0.862mg Beef shank
Phenylalanine 1.176mg 1.315mg Beef shank
Valine 1.407mg 1.638mg Beef shank
Histidine 0.716mg 1.153mg Beef shank
Cholesterol 85mg 78mg Beef shank
Saturated Fat 1g 2.29g Ostrich
Monounsaturated Fat 0.97g 2.86g Beef shank
Polyunsaturated fat 0.44g 0.21g Ostrich
